Also, I decided I really like sewing these kind of things with stripes, because it makes it so much easier to cut out rectangles and to sew or iron in straight lines, etc. This is the front placket. You can see how there is a pleat on the right side/outside, and then the raw edge is encased in the pleat on the wrong side/inside.

Bonus petticoat pictures. While my cotton lawn petticoat is lovely and delicate and soft, this stiffer poplin really gives a great shape because it has so much more body, especially with the flounce. Lazy picture of it over my ensemble skirt on the dress form.
P1020546
And this is how the flounce was applied. The gathered edge is sewn into a tuck in the petticoat. So there is more petticoat under the flounce and the flounce sits on top. This keeps the raw edge all covered and neat. Plus, tuck for bonus stiffening around the circumference.
